Huskies season ends in GLIAC Quarterfinals
Huskies season ends in GLIAC Quarterfinals

April 29, 2022

No. 6 seed Michigan Tech came up short 4-1 against No. 3 seed Grand Valley State in the GLIAC women's tennis quarterfinals Friday afternoon outdoors at Greater Midland Tennis Center. Nicole Ballach triumphed over Vera Griva 6-3, 7-5 at No. 1 singles for the Huskies, but the Lakers outplayed Tech in three other singles positions as well as doubles to move into the semifinals against No. 2 seed Wayne State on Saturday.

Huskies stymied by Warriors 7-0
Huskies stymied by Warriors 7-0

April 09, 2022

Late scratches from the singles lineup and strong play by Wayne State doomed Michigan Tech in a 7-0 loss to the Warriors Saturday at WSU Courts in GLIAC play. The Huskies dropped their second match of the weekend as Wayne State swept doubles and did not drop a set in singles to improve to 10-6, 5-0 GLIAC. MTU fell to 1-8, 1-4 GLIAC with four regular season matches to play.

Huskies upended by #24 Grand Valley State
Huskies upended by #24 Grand Valley State

March 27, 2022

No. 24 Grand Valley State seized the team doubles point and grabbed five singles wins to defeat Michigan Tech 6-1 in women's tennis Sunday morning at Grand Rapids Racquet & Fitness Center. Lauren Opalewski was the lone winner for the Huskies at No. 5 singles as MTU suffered its sixth straight defeat to start the spring season.
